Warning Signs Your Lighting Needs Professional Repair
When your home's lighting starts acting up, it is usually trying to tell you something specific about the health of your electrical system. Recognizing these early warning signs can save you from unexpected outages and severe safety hazards.
Flickering or Dimming Light Fixtures
You notice your ceiling lights or lamps momentarily dim or flicker, especially when a major appliance, HVAC unit, or well pump turns on. While an occasional flicker during a severe Central Florida storm is normal, consistent dimming indicates a localized voltage drop. This usually means the lighting circuit is overloaded, or there is a deteriorating neutral connection somewhere in your electrical system.
Ignoring this symptom stresses sensitive electronics and LED drivers, causing premature failure of your fixtures. More importantly, if the cause is a loose connection, it creates electrical resistance that generates dangerous heat inside your walls. A professional diagnostic is required to trace the circuit and identify exactly where the voltage is dropping.
Buzzing or Humming at the Switch or Fixture
When you turn on a light, you hear a distinct, continuous buzzing or crackling noise coming from the wall switch or the fixture itself. This is almost always caused by incompatible hardware, like modern LED bulbs paired with older incandescent dimmer switches, or dangerous electrical arcing. Arcing occurs when electrical current jumps across a loose connection instead of flowing smoothly through the wire.
If you are dealing with an incompatible dimmer, it will quickly destroy your expensive new bulbs and potentially damage the switch. If it is arcing, the switch will eventually melt or spark, posing an immediate fire risk that requires professional intervention. We can quickly determine whether you need a simple switch upgrade or a more complex wiring repair.
Unusually Rapid Bulb Burnout
You find yourself replacing bulbs in the same fixture every few weeks or months, particularly in outdoor lanai fixtures, dock lighting, or enclosed ceiling fans. Bulbs burn out quickly due to excess voltage, excessive vibration, or trapped heat in poorly ventilated fixtures. Outdoors in Babson Park, this rapid failure is often a sign of moisture corroding the socket contacts.
Continuously replacing bulbs is a waste of money that treats the symptom rather than the actual electrical disease. A professional needs to meter the voltage and inspect the socket integrity before the fixture shorts out entirely. We can replace damaged sockets and ensure your fixtures are properly rated for their location.
Switches or Fixtures That Are Hot to the Touch
When you touch the plastic wall plate of a light switch or the trim of a recessed ceiling light, it feels uncomfortably warm or hot. Switches should never generate noticeable heat during normal operation. This heat indicates that the switch is failing, the circuit is carrying more current than it is rated for, or the wrong wattage bulb is installed in an enclosed fixture.
Heat is the ultimate enemy of electrical insulation in your home. Left unchecked, the wire coating will become brittle and crack, exposing bare wires and creating a severe fire hazard inside your walls or attic. Shut off power to that switch immediately and have a professional evaluate the circuit.
Common Causes Behind Lighting Failures in Babson Park
Understanding why your lights are failing helps take the guesswork out of the repair process. In our area, we see a specific mix of environmental and age-related factors impacting residential lighting systems. Here is what is likely happening behind your drywall.
Moisture Intrusion and Corrosion
Water vapor and high humidity slowly seep into outdoor light fixtures, patio ceiling fans, and landscape lighting connections, oxidizing the metal contacts. Given our proximity to Crooked Lake and the high ambient humidity in Babson Park, outdoor electrical components simply degrade faster here. Even seals marketed as weatherproof eventually dry rot and fail, allowing moisture to bridge electrical connections.
The solution involves replacing the corroded sockets or fixtures and upgrading to highly rated wet-location housings. We also ensure all junction boxes are properly sealed to prevent future moisture ingress and protect your outdoor living spaces. This proactive approach extends the life of your exterior lighting significantly.
Incompatible LED Retrofitting
Homeowners frequently upgrade their old, energy-hungry incandescent bulbs to modern LEDs, only to find the new lights strobe, flicker, or hum loudly. Older homes often have dimmer switches designed specifically for the heavy resistive load of incandescent bulbs. LEDs use complex electronic drivers that require specialized, compatible dimmer switches to regulate the current smoothly.
A technician will map the lighting circuit and replace outdated switches with modern, LED-compatible dimmers. This ensures smooth, quiet operation while maximizing the lifespan of your new energy-efficient bulbs. We can also verify that the LED bulbs themselves are dimmable, as using non-dimmable bulbs on any dimmer will cause immediate issues.
Degraded or Loose Wiring Connections
Over time, the wire nuts connecting your light fixtures to your home's wiring can loosen, or the older wires themselves become brittle. In established properties, years of thermal expansion and contraction cause these vital connections to slowly back out. Every time the wire heats up during use and cools when turned off, the connection weakens slightly.
Resolving this requires a technician to drop the fixture, inspect the junction box, and cut back any damaged wire. We then secure new, tight connections that meet current safety codes and restore reliable power flow. This meticulous attention to detail prevents future connection failures and eliminates arcing risks.
Overloaded Lighting Circuits
Too many lights, ceiling fans, or added outlets are drawing power from a single circuit breaker, pushing it past its safe operational capacity. As homeowners finish rooms, add exterior lighting, or plug high-draw devices into circuits originally designed just for lighting, the system becomes bottlenecked. This is especially common in older homes that were not wired for modern electrical demands.
We will calculate the total amperage draw on the circuit to determine the best path forward. The fix may involve splitting the load, running a new dedicated circuit for heavy devices, or updating the breakers entirely. Balancing the electrical load ensures your lights stay bright and your breakers stop tripping.
